Q » How do professionals handle bee relocation?

A » Professionals handle bee relocation by first assessing the hive's location and size, then using specialized equipment to safely transfer the bees to a new habitat. This often involves calming the bees with smoke, carefully removing the hive, and ensuring the queen bee is relocated with the colony. The process prioritizes the safety of both the bees and the surrounding environment, often collaborating with local beekeepers for sustainable solutions.
